
Actress Shin Ye-eun has renewed her contract with her agency, NPio. On the 10th, NPio stated in a press release, "We have signed a renewal contract with actress Shin Ye-eun based on a strong trust. We are very pleased to continue this valuable partnership. We will continue to provide full support with unwavering commitment so that actress Shin Ye-eun can work in a more enjoyable and comfortable environment."
Shin Ye-eun debuted in 2018 with the web drama "A-Teen," playing the role of Do Hana. Since her debut, Shin Ye-eun has gained public love by creating the "Do Hana Syndrome" with her fresh charm and stable acting skills. She has actively continued her career by appearing in various works such as "Psychometry Guy," "Welcome," "More Than Friends," "Third Person Revenge," "The Glory," "Lovers of the Red Sky," "Jungnyeon," "A Hundred Memories," and "Turbulence."
Shin Ye-eun has proven a wide acting spectrum across various genres including school dramas, thrillers, historical dramas, and period pieces, steadily building her own filmography. Notably, she gave a passionate performance as the young Park Yeon-jin in "The Glory," received great public acclaim for her roles as Heo Young-seo in "Jungnyeon" and Seo Jong-hee in the recently concluded "A Hundred Memories." Through these performances, Shin Ye-eun has firmly established her acting skills and presence.
Currently, Shin Ye-eun is filming for the Genie TV original drama "Johnber Doctor" (working title), scheduled for release in 2026, where she plays the role of nurse Yuk Ha-ri, who appears with a secret past. This project is expected to showcase a new transformation in Shin Ye-eun's acting.
Through her contract renewal with NPio, Shin Ye-eun plans to continue her activities steadily. NPio highly values Shin Ye-eun's acting skills and charm and stated that they will support her further development. Shin Ye-eun is expected to continue actively participating in various works in the future.
